【问题标题】:How to skip downstream jenkins job based on upstream job status code如何根据上游作业状态码跳过下游 jenkins 作业
【发布时间】:2020-09-08 07:21:47
【问题描述】:

我有一个 jenkins 上游工作 Job_A,它有一个下游工作 Job_B。如果在特定目录中未找到文件,则 Job_A 返回状态代码 (10)。但我不希望 Job_A 失败,如果上游作业以状态码 (10) 退出,我想跳过下游作业。有人可以帮助如何做到这一点吗?我对 Jenkins 完全陌生。

以下是高级图表。 jenkins-job-condition

我尝试过Jenkin's conditional step,但找不到合适的解决方案。

【问题讨论】:

    标签: jenkins


    【解决方案1】:

    您应该通过在 Post-build Actions 中添加 Build other projects 来定义 upstream 作业的条件,如下所示。

    【讨论】:

      猜你喜欢
      • 2011-09-02
      • 2019-04-06
      • 2014-12-18
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多